Output 81d07e973774306608aceae1b2ff62204fcdfdb9d43592a6b49381fe106a04d0:0

value
1983410261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e014d6039653641d6b84366012db506292d5185 OP_EQUAL
address
3Qr57kV9VaPYrut2MVowEiMX4YrjGG46kR
transaction
81d07e973774306608aceae1b2ff62204fcdfdb9d43592a6b49381fe106a04d0
confirmations
374520
spent
true